TaskSchema: ZodObject<{
Agent: ZodNullable<ZodString>;
AgentID: ZodNullable<ZodString>;
CompletedAt: ZodNullable<ZodDate>;
ConversationDetailID: ZodNullable<ZodString>;
Description: ZodNullable<ZodString>;
DueAt: ZodNullable<ZodDate>;
Environment: ZodString;
EnvironmentID: ZodString;
ID: ZodString;
Name: ZodString;
Parent: ZodNullable<ZodString>;
ParentID: ZodNullable<ZodString>;
PercentComplete: ZodNullable<ZodNumber>;
Project: ZodNullable<ZodString>;
ProjectID: ZodNullable<ZodString>;
RootParentID: ZodNullable<ZodString>;
StartedAt: ZodNullable<ZodDate>;
Status: ZodUnion<[ZodLiteral<"Blocked">, ZodLiteral<"Cancelled">, ZodLiteral<"Complete">, ZodLiteral<"Deferred">, ZodLiteral<"Failed">, ZodLiteral<"In Progress">, ZodLiteral<"Pending">]>;
Type: ZodString;
TypeID: ZodString;
User: ZodNullable<ZodString>;
UserID: ZodNullable<ZodString>;
__mj_CreatedAt: ZodDate;
__mj_UpdatedAt: ZodDate;
}, "strip", ZodTypeAny, {
Agent?: string;
AgentID?: string;
CompletedAt?: Date;
ConversationDetailID?: string;
Description?: string;
DueAt?: Date;
Environment?: string;
EnvironmentID?: string;
ID?: string;
Name?: string;
Parent?: string;
ParentID?: string;
PercentComplete?: number;
Project?: string;
ProjectID?: string;
RootParentID?: string;
StartedAt?: Date;
Status?: "Pending" | "Complete" | "Failed" | "In Progress" | "Cancelled" | "Blocked" | "Deferred";
Type?: string;
TypeID?: string;
User?: string;
UserID?: string;
__mj_CreatedAt?: Date;
__mj_UpdatedAt?: Date;
}, {
Agent?: string;
AgentID?: string;
CompletedAt?: Date;
ConversationDetailID?: string;
Description?: string;
DueAt?: Date;
Environment?: string;
EnvironmentID?: string;
ID?: string;
Name?: string;
Parent?: string;
ParentID?: string;
PercentComplete?: number;
Project?: string;
ProjectID?: string;
RootParentID?: string;
StartedAt?: Date;
Status?: "Pending" | "Complete" | "Failed" | "In Progress" | "Cancelled" | "Blocked" | "Deferred";
Type?: string;
TypeID?: string;
User?: string;
UserID?: string;
__mj_CreatedAt?: Date;
__mj_UpdatedAt?: Date;
}> = ...
Type declaration
Agent: ZodNullable<ZodString>
AgentID: ZodNullable<ZodString>
CompletedAt: ZodNullable<ZodDate>
ConversationDetailID: ZodNullable<ZodString>
Description: ZodNullable<ZodString>
DueAt: ZodNullable<ZodDate>
Environment: ZodString
EnvironmentID: ZodString
ID: ZodString
Name: ZodString
Parent: ZodNullable<ZodString>
ParentID: ZodNullable<ZodString>
PercentComplete: ZodNullable<ZodNumber>
Project: ZodNullable<ZodString>
ProjectID: ZodNullable<ZodString>
RootParentID: ZodNullable<ZodString>
StartedAt: ZodNullable<ZodDate>
Status: ZodUnion<[ZodLiteral<"Blocked">, ZodLiteral<"Cancelled">, ZodLiteral<"Complete">, ZodLiteral<"Deferred">, ZodLiteral<"Failed">, ZodLiteral<"In Progress">, ZodLiteral<"Pending">]>
Type: ZodString
TypeID: ZodString
User: ZodNullable<ZodString>
UserID: ZodNullable<ZodString>
__mj_CreatedAt: ZodDate
__mj_UpdatedAt: ZodDate
Type declaration
Optional Agent?: string
Optional AgentID?: string
Optional CompletedAt?: Date
Optional ConversationDetailID?: string
Optional Description?: string
Optional DueAt?: Date
Optional Environment?: string
Optional EnvironmentID?: string
Optional ID?: string
Optional Name?: string
Optional Parent?: string
Optional ParentID?: string
Optional PercentComplete?: number
Optional Project?: string
Optional ProjectID?: string
Optional RootParentID?: string
Optional StartedAt?: Date
Optional Status?: "Pending" | "Complete" | "Failed" | "In Progress" | "Cancelled" | "Blocked" | "Deferred"
Optional Type?: string
Optional TypeID?: string
Optional User?: string
Optional UserID?: string
Optional __mj_CreatedAt?: Date
Optional __mj_UpdatedAt?: Date
Type declaration
Optional Agent?: string
Optional AgentID?: string
Optional CompletedAt?: Date
Optional ConversationDetailID?: string
Optional Description?: string
Optional DueAt?: Date
Optional Environment?: string
Optional EnvironmentID?: string
Optional ID?: string
Optional Name?: string
Optional Parent?: string
Optional ParentID?: string
Optional PercentComplete?: number
Optional Project?: string
Optional ProjectID?: string
Optional RootParentID?: string
Optional StartedAt?: Date
Optional Status?: "Pending" | "Complete" | "Failed" | "In Progress" | "Cancelled" | "Blocked" | "Deferred"
Optional Type?: string
Optional TypeID?: string
Optional User?: string
Optional UserID?: string
Optional __mj_CreatedAt?: Date
Optional __mj_UpdatedAt?: Date
zod schema definition for the entity MJ: Tasks